I'm trying to paint the rubber/plastic covered outer lower window trim on my hatchback. Is there some kind of trick to getting if off without bending it? I can't seem to find any attachment points on any of them. The diagrams I've seen in various places are small and blurry. Are there any how-to's or photos to this effect?

I was using a small screwdriver to pull that stuff off a car I was scrapping. They came off without any damage, just had to be careful. I think they pretty much just snap into place at a few points but I didn't really look closely.
